The last time I checked, Maserati, Lamborghini, BMW, and lotus all use koni shocks for their factory setups... and these are all sports cars made specifically for sports driving.

I've installed numerous sets of Koni shock/struts and have had 0 problems with fitment, ride quality, and longevity under harsh(lowered) conditions. I've heard all too many times about a tokico shock giving up after only 3-6 months of regular use on a lowered vehicle. If the koni's under extreme conditions can outlast their competitors under normal driving conditions then the victor is obvious. Do some research though.. you'll find alot of unhappy Tokico owners in alot of web boards, that's what influenced my not to carry the line.

The KYB AGX and GR-2 are also good aftermarket strut/shocks at very reasonable prices. good luck
